python中Mako库实例用法
程序员文章站
2022-09-21 16:16:31
mako是一个模板库。一种嵌入式的语言,能够实现简化组件布局以及继承,主要的用途也是和作用域有关,但是效果是最直接切灵活的,这些都是mako的基本功能,掌握了基础内容,接下来就是详细的了解讲述,从几个...
mako是一个模板库。一种嵌入式的语言,能够实现简化组件布局以及继承,主要的用途也是和作用域有关,但是效果是最直接切灵活的,这些都是mako的基本功能,掌握了基础内容,接下来就是详细的了解讲述,从几个方面为大家详细讲述,首先在众多模板库中的优点,以及实例应用等等,一起来了解学习下吧。
mako的优点:
学习成本低,能够在结构上进行转义。
应用方向:
文本文件生成。
模块引用:
from mako.template import template
基本用法:
from mako.template import template t = template('hello world!') print t.render()
python模板库mako的用法
集成mako
在django中集成mako
通过django的中间件可以集成mako。首先需要安装django-mako模块。
在django项目的settings.py文件中,修改 middleware_classes ,添加 djangomako.middleware.makomiddleware 。使用 render_to_response() 函数即可使用:
from djangomako.shortcuts import render_to_response def hello_view(request): return render_to_response('hello.txt', {'name': 'yeolar'})
到此这篇关于python中mako库实例用法的文章就介绍到这了,更多相关python中mako库怎么用内容请搜索以前的文章或继续浏览下面的相关文章希望大家以后多多支持!
上一篇: 考试连作七科弊真狠
下一篇: 爆笑男女 内涵搞笑,实在是太不纯洁了